Overview: In a recent meeting, the Ocean Township Planning Board engaged in a detailed and contentious discussion regarding the potential redevelopment and condemnation of a property located on Highway 35. The board debated the evidence needed to designate the site as an area in need of redevelopment with condemnation, with members expressing differing opinions on whether the statutory criteria were met. The meeting culminated in a narrow vote to approve the redevelopment report, which included condemnation recommendations, amidst ongoing disputes over the property’s condition and management.

Overview: The Ocean Township Planning Board convened to deliberate on the potential redevelopment of the Orchard Plaza Shopping Center, located on Highway 35. With an 85% vacancy rate and significant signs of deterioration, the board explored whether the property meets the criteria for redevelopment as a condemnation area. The session emphasized the importance of accurate data and community involvement, as the decision could shape the future of this nearly 11-acre site.

Overview: The Ocean Planning Board convened to discuss and ultimately approve a significant expansion for the Fisherman’s Source building on Sunset Avenue, a key topic during their recent meeting. This development involves both a substantial increase in building size and a reconfiguration of the site to accommodate the business’s growing focus on e-commerce and warehousing, alongside improvements in parking, site circulation, and lighting.

Overview: The Ocean Planning Board recently approved a minor subdivision proposal for a property on Holbrook Street, despite concerns about wetlands and the need for multiple variances. The decision followed discussions about the compatibility of the new lots with the surrounding neighborhood and the legal nuances of the variance application. The approval included conditions to ensure compliance with technical requirements and neighborhood standards.
